What is a Neck Lift?
A neck lift tightens the skin, removes excess fat, and eliminates sagging skin around the neck and jawline. This procedure is ideal for those dealing with turkey neck, jowls, and loose skin that results from aging or weight fluctuations.

The Neck Lift Procedure
The surgery involves small incisions under the chin and behind the ears to lift and tighten the skin and underlying muscles. Dr. Brenman’s advanced techniques ensure natural-looking results with minimal scarring, leaving patients with a rejuvenated, youthful appearance.

Recovery and Results
After the surgery, some swelling and bruising are expected, but most patients return to their regular activities within 10-14 days. Results are long-lasting, especially when combined with a healthy lifestyle and proper skincare regimen.
